Bottle from Just In Beer, Groningen. Aroma is softly fruity and floral with zesty citrus, fruit peel, wheaty malt, grain, grassy hops, mild spicy yeast. Flavour is light to moderate sweet and moderate bitter. Body is light to medium. Subtle and easy Wheat Ale.

Bottle 33cl. from de Boerenjongens @home poured into a footed pilsner glass. Cloudy yellow golden colour, mid-sized frrothy white head, half-way lasting, a few small yeast circles, fair lacing. Aroma wheat, yeast, light citrus, melon, cloves notes. Taste light to medium sweet and bitter, wheat, light citrus, spicy notes. Light to medium body, watery to oily texture, soft carbonation, dry sweetbitter aftertaste, light chalky notes, light lingering grain notes, nice.

Bottle. Color: Lightly hazy golden, white head. Aroma: Coriander, wheat malt, yeasty. Taste: Quite a lot of coriander. Wheat malt, yeasty notes, orangepeel and subtle lemon. Hoppy background, light hints of tropical fruit. Medium body, average carbonation. Ok Witbier
